The Body's Protein Buffer System

Unlike carbohydrates or fats, the body doesn't have a dedicated storage depot for protein. However, it does possess a highly efficient internal system for managing amino acids, the building blocks of protein. For a single day, this system acts as a buffer, ensuring vital functions continue uninterrupted. The body maintains a circulating pool of free amino acids, drawn from both your diet and the ongoing breakdown and recycling of your own body's proteins. If you don't meet your protein needs for one day, your body simply taps into this reservoir, using recycled amino acids to prioritize essential functions. Only under conditions of chronic, severe starvation does the body begin to break down muscle tissue to harvest amino acids for vital organs. This means a temporary dip in intake is not an emergency for your system.

Short-Term Effects You Might Notice

While your body is excellent at compensating for short-term deficits, you might still feel some mild, temporary effects. The most common is a change in appetite. Protein is a key driver of satiety, the feeling of fullness and satisfaction after a meal. When a meal lacks adequate protein, it may digest faster and leave you feeling hungry much sooner. This can lead to increased cravings for carbohydrates and sugary foods as your body seeks a quick energy fix.

Another subtle effect might be a slight dip in energy. Protein is a component of many enzymes and hormones that regulate energy metabolism. While not a dramatic effect from a single day's miss, some people might notice a minor decrease in stamina or feel a little more sluggish than usual, especially if they are very active. For most sedentary adults, however, this change would be virtually imperceptible.

Considerations for Active Individuals

For athletes and those engaged in regular, strenuous exercise, a low-protein day could have more noticeable, though still minor, consequences. Muscle repair and growth, a process known as muscle protein synthesis, relies on a steady supply of amino acids. Missing your protein window after an intense workout could slow the recovery process. This might manifest as slightly prolonged muscle soreness or fatigue, rather than a significant loss of muscle mass. Consistent protein intake is far more crucial for long-term muscle building and repair than a single post-workout meal. Missing one opportunity is not enough to derail your fitness goals.

Chronic Deficiency: A Different Story

It is essential to understand the difference between a one-day shortfall and a chronic, long-term deficiency. The mild, temporary effects of a single low-protein day are a far cry from the serious health issues caused by consistent under-consumption. True protein deficiency is rare in developed countries but can occur in individuals with very poor, restrictive diets or certain medical conditions.

Table: Short-Term vs. Long-Term Protein Effects

Aspect Single Day Low Protein Chronic Low Protein
Muscle Mass No measurable loss Significant muscle wasting and weakness
Energy Levels Mild, temporary dip or slight fatigue Persistent weakness, exhaustion, and lethargy
Satiety Increased hunger and cravings Constant, unsatisfied hunger leading to potential weight fluctuations
Immune System Negligible, unaffected Weakened immunity, frequent illness, and slow healing
Hair/Skin/Nails No visible change Brittle hair and nails, dry/flaky skin, impaired collagen production
Bone Health No immediate impact Reduced bone mineral density and increased fracture risk

Long-Term Consequences of Low Protein

When low protein intake becomes a consistent pattern, the body's compensatory mechanisms are eventually overwhelmed. The most visible effects often include muscle atrophy and persistent fatigue. Over time, the body is forced to break down muscle tissue to obtain the amino acids needed for more critical functions, leading to muscle weakness and loss of strength.

Beyond muscle, the immune system also suffers. Proteins are essential for producing antibodies and other components of the immune response. A prolonged lack of protein can compromise your body's ability to fight off infections, making you more susceptible to illness and slowing wound healing. Furthermore, the health of your hair, skin, and nails, all of which are made largely of proteins like collagen and keratin, will deteriorate, becoming brittle or dry.

How to Get Back on Track After One Day

Since a single day of low protein is not a major issue, the solution is simple: resume your normal, balanced eating pattern. There is no need for drastic overcompensation. The key is consistency, not daily perfection.

Here are some simple steps to follow:

  • Prioritize a High-Protein Breakfast: Distributing protein throughout the day can help maximize muscle protein synthesis. Aim for a protein-rich breakfast the next morning to start strong.
  • Include Protein at Every Meal: Ensure your lunch and dinner contain a solid protein source, such as lean meat, fish, eggs, dairy, or legumes.
  • Listen to Your Body: If you feel hungrier than usual, reach for a healthy, protein-packed snack like a handful of almonds, Greek yogurt, or a piece of cheese to curb cravings and promote satiety.
  • Consider Whole Foods First: While supplements can be helpful, it's best to meet your needs with a variety of whole foods that offer a full spectrum of nutrients.
